Use Disk Utility‘s Repair Disk function to clean up any problems with your hard drive.You either access this by holding down the Shift key while starting up your Mac (Intel) or, if you have an M1 Mac, press and continue to hold the power button until you see the startup options appear > choose your startup disk > press and hold Shift > click Continue in Safe Mode. Use Safe Mode, which launches macOS without any additional processes and runs clean-up scripts.If you use apps with plug-ins, you should disable (or remove) them to discover if they are causing problems. ![]()
